Water museum in Hangzhou wins provincial recognition
The National Water Museum of China is shaped as a pagoda. [Photo/hangzhou.com.cn]
The National Water Museum of China in Xiaoshan district, Hangzhou, East China's Zhejiang province has recently been recognized as a provincial demonstration that showcases the achievements of river management in Zhejiang.
Opened to the public in 2010, the museum not only showcases the water management in Zhejiang, but also displays the development of water conservancy projects and water-related culture in China.
